Asking the person for a date

How much ever a brave heart we might be as a person, when it actually comes to asking a person for a date, one generally develops weak knees. Understandable! There is always this fear of rejection. What if she says no? Does it mean that she’s not interested in me? Does it mean she does not like me? Well, this is not true. For starters, everyone gets a weak knee when they have to ask someone for a date. Though it is not something as big as proposing for marriage, it is at least a tiny step most likely leading to that very question soon. Do not let the fear of rejection hold you back from dating. Take dating as a very casual social activity just like going and playing a game of snooker. Yes, even a game of snooker can actually be a date if both you and your partner are snooker addicts. So make the first move. Choose the right time and the right moment to ask. When you have to ask make sure that you take him or her to a place where there aren’t too many people to over hear your personal conversation. This is done so that both the people feel comfortable. Be polite and take the response, whatever it may be in a gentle manner. Don’t take it too personally. Remember, dating is just like any other activity. Another common misconception is that guys get put off if a girl makes the first move in the dating arena. This is not true at all. There are many guys who are shy to make the first move. So the girls can actually ask them for a date, making the first move. Once this is done, the guy will be glad and thank you and take on from there onwards.
